
The Steve Allen Show
The Steve Allen Show was a popular American late-night television variety program that aired from 1956 to 1960. Hosted by Steve Allen, the show featured a mix of comedy sketches, musical performances, interviews, and comedy routines. It was known for its innovative and relaxed style, setting the tone for future late-night shows. The program also introduced the first late-night comedy monologue and many other television firsts. Its influence helped shape the format of modern late-night TV, and it launched the careers of several notable comedians and performers.
